Color Our World: Fabric Batik

Color Our World: Fabric Batik In-Person

Discover the timeless art of batik in a hands-on workshop! We'll explore the beauty and cultural heritage of this fabric dyeing technique -- from pattern creation to the resist-dyeing process.

The two-day beginner-friendly session will guide you through each step, empowering you to create your own unique fabric artwork. No prior experience is needed -- just bring your creativity and a willingness to experiment, and leave with a vibrant piece of wearable or displayable art. Suitable for tweens, teens, and adults.

Note: This program takes place over two days. The first day will cover creating the resist, and on the second day participants will dye the fabric.
